The LintLoom API checks your docs for broken anchors, stale version strings, and heading drift before each release cut. Hit the /validate endpoint with your doc bundle and it'll return a tidy report in a few seconds. All requests go through the internal Weftgate proxy, which needs authentication. Use the key below for release pipelines.

app token of kagap-fafop = zpat7_kxsDrhD

TURN-208: Gatevale turnstile counters at the Merrow Field pilot double-count when a rotation reverses mid-cycle. Attendance totals drift roughly 2% high per event. The debounce window fix is implemented, reviewed by Ilsa, and soak-tested across two simulated match days without drift. Ready for your cut; the candidate build is identified below.

trace token, tagag-tafog: htk6_5ed18c

MEMO — Kettling Depot Receiving

Uniform sets for the new Kettling depot arrive Wednesday via Ashgrove courier: 40 boxes, sorted by size, manifest attached to box one. Check the count at the dock before signing; shortages go straight to stores, not the courier. The hand-over instruction the courier will follow is set out below.

drop instructions, tafof-baguf: the holmir gilox courier leaves the sormir ulaok holdor ledger at gate 5596 under passcode 257343

Cold-start test plan for the Tindery serverless handlers. Scope: checkout, refund, and notify functions. Method: force cold starts by scaling to zero, then fire one request each and record p95 init latency in the Copperfen dashboard. Pass threshold: under 900 ms. Support should run this after every runtime upgrade and attach results to the release ticket. Known issue: the notify handler occasionally double-logs its init line; ignore it. To invoke the staging functions directly, authenticate with the token below.

session JWT of yawep-yawep = eyJhbGciOiJIUzI1NiIsInR5cCI6IkpXVCJ9.eyJzdWIiOiI3pWF3_In0.aXYsHiog